FINASTRA TO SUPPORT BANCO DE MEXICO WITH FUSIONRISK AS IT SAFEGUARDS THE COUNTRY’S FINANCIAL SYSTEM
- Mexico’s central bank will replace its legacy risk management system
- Bank expects to reduce the time it takes to calculate daily value at risk
Mexico’s central bank, Banco de Mexico, has selected Finastrato transform its legacy risk management platform. The central bank expects to deploy FusionRisk with the goal of enabling faster, more sophisticated risk analysis as ever-changing and volatile markets add new layers of complexity to effective risk management for Mexico’s financial system.
In evaluating various risk management solutions, Banco de Mexico found that FusionRisk from Finastra best suited its needs for a dynamic system capable of bringing greater speed and efficiency to risk management and reporting in a time of increasing global uncertainty.
The heightened profile of Mexico in world politics, coupled with events such as Brexit and the US election, places the region firmly on the world’s stage. Central bank activity and the ability to analyze and understand the financial impact of recent market events have become even more crucial. The growing size and complexity of the Mexican financial system highlighted Banco de Mexico’s need to advance its legacy risk management system.
Daily analysis of exposures, including scenario simulations, is an essential task to ensure financial and economic stability. The implementation of FusionRisk will help the central bank address stability concerns, reducing the time it takes to calculate daily value at risk (VAR).
“The role of central banks in analyzing, detecting and preventing high risk events impacting their country’s financial system is vital,” said Nadeem Syed, CEO at Finastra. “It takes powerful and reliable technology to tackle these challenges and create an environment where fast and sophisticated risk analysis becomes par for the course. We are well placed to support the needs of Banco de Mexico as it works to transform its architecture and safeguard the Latin America region with a next-generation risk infrastructure.”
FusionRisk uses a “top down” approach to risk management that provides an entity-, subsidiary- and trader-level view of exposures, along with sophisticated analytics, to help banks meet the rising demands of regulators, shareholders and boards for transparency. Working alongside existing IT investments, FusionRisk helps institutions focus more on cost control and productivity gains.
